Job summary

An exciting opportunity has arisen for a dynamic, motivated and professional senior administrator to join the PALS & Complaints Team at University Hospitals Bristol and Weston NHS Foundation Trust. This position is offered on a full-time basis, with supervision of our existing small team of administrators. The post holder will be responsible for dealing with telephone calls, triaging all new enquiries to the service and managing the administrative processes within the department, as well as managing their own caseload of PALS Enquiries and Concerns.

If you are able to work well under pressure and enjoy dealing directly with people, we would like to hear from you. You will need to have experience of working in a busy customer focused role, which includes dealing with difficult and challenging enquiries. In return we can offer you a role where no two days are the same and enables you to improve the experience of patients, visitors and carers who use our services.

Main duties of the job

To provide a high level of customer service to patients, relatives and visitors who may need information or advice about Trust and hospital services. To support and signpost people with concerns or queries to ensure timely resolution of issues.

The post holder will be required to work in a busy and demanding environment and should be able to work without direct supervision and to exercise initiative. The ability to multi-task is also essential.

To provide information and advice to patients and carers on the NHS complaints procedure and, subject to their choice, assist and support clients in making a complaint or refer them to appropriate independent advocacy services.

To supervise the day-to-day operation of administration functions to maintain provision of high-quality services and effective working relationships, including supporting a team of administrators and taking operational responsibility for the allocation of work.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website .

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ants .
